#WCW Women’s History Month Trivia Night

First, she what you know at this annual trivia night from the YWCA National Capital Region and the Young Women's Leadership Council. In addition to the fun of it, proceeds from the evening will go toward scholarships for young girls of color to attend a career-oriented summer camp.

When: Wednesday, March 13, 6-9 p.m.
Where: HalfSmoke, 651 Florida Ave. NW
Price: $10 suggested donation

Age-In-Place Volunteer Orientation

Next, become a volunteer helping older adults in D.C. Wards 4, 5 and 6 age in place. This orientation session at the non-profit Seabury Resources for Aging will tell you how.

When: Thursday, March 14, 5:30-7:30 p.m.
Where: The Age-In-Place Office, 2501 18th St. NE
Price: Free

Cocktails for Calvary - Spring Edition

Then, Calvary Women's Services is the beneficiary of finds raised at this cocktail event at Baby Wale. Calvary helps offers health, education and employment to women overcoming homelessness in Anacostia.

When: Thursday, March 14, 6-8 p.m.
Where: Baby Wale, 1124 Ninth St. NW
Price: $25

Alchemy of Great Taste 2019

Finally, this silent auction held in the North Hall of Eastern Market will help the Tyler Elementary PTA provide food, arts, after school and other programs to neighborhood students. Music, dancing, and food and drink from local providers like Pupatella Neapolitan Pizza and ANXO Cidery will enhance the festive atmosphere. 

When: Saturday, March 16, 7-11 p.m.
Where: Eastern Market North Hall, 225 Seventh St. SE
Price: $50
